## Data CoordinatorApplyremote type: On-sitelocations: Boulder, CO (E)time type: Full timeposted on: Posted 2 Days Agojob requisition id: JR101513**JOB SUMMARY**The Data Coordinator is responsible for the creation and quality control of data files in pre-clinical efficacy studies and various supplementary appendices for study technical reports. They partner with various scientific staff to ensure accuracy and consistency of the data with adherence to templates and project timelines.**JOB RESPONSIBILITIES*** Create Excel files for data collection of pre-clinical research studies* Quality control of study spreadsheets at various project stages* Verify findings and review raw data, consulting the appropriate scientist regarding any abnormalities* Review study protocols and amendments for relevant study information* Compile graphs, data tables, data packages for clear interpretation of study results* Work with pathologists to capture, annotate, and assemble photomicrographs of slides* Maintain study spreadsheet templates* Maintain cooperative & communicative attitude (coordinating activities, offering to help others when you have down time)* Interact with clients, other employees, and the community in a professional manner* Support and participate in company initiatives* Perform other duties as assigned**SKILLS AND ABILITIES*** Detail-oriented; efficient quality control of data* A working knowledge and awareness of general laboratory procedures* Good organizational skills* Ability to use various software programs* Ability to work independently* Good written and oral communication skills**MINIMUM EDUCATION AND QUALIFICATIONS*** Bachelor's degree or higher in a biology-related discipline* Proficient in Microsoft Office products* Working knowledge of Adobe Creative Cloud* Experience in experimental design* Experience in collecting and graphing scientific data* Experience in performing statistical analysis preferred* Equivalent combination of related education and required work experience considered**WORKING CONDITIONS*** Work is normally performed in a typical interior office* Option for a hybrid schedule* Prolonged periods of sitting at a desk and working on a computer* Teamwork setting* Consistent written and verbal communication**Salary Range:** $24-$28 per hour adjusted according to the level of the role and the candidate’s relevant experience and/or education. Salary will be commensurate with experience and responsibilities.**Benefits:** Health and dental coverage, short- and long-term disability, paid time off, paid parental leave, 401(k), and more.**Position Status:** Open until filled**Additional Information:*** Hybrid options potentially available after 3 months of employment based on business needs.#LI-JM1#LI-Onsite*\*This position could be offered at different levels for candidates who qualify with a combination of advanced levels of education and/or years of experience.
